
Today marks a year since the Velykomostivska community lost a Hero — Mykhailo Pentsak.
Mykhailo Pentsak was born in the village of Boyanets, studied at Turynkivska School and the technical college of Lviv Polytechnic. After his studies, he worked as a miner at the Zarichna and Lisova mines. He was known as a kind, sincere, honest, and fair person.
In 2020, Mykhailo was mobilized to defend Ukraine. He was awarded the ‘Participant of the ATO’ medal. With the start of the full-scale war, he continued to serve in the hottest sectors of the front such as Lysychansk and Bakhmut, for the defense of which he received a recognition.
On September 5, 2024, while performing a combat mission in the area of Chasiv Yar in Donetsk region, Mykhailo gave his life for the freedom and independence of Ukraine. He was posthumously awarded the order of the 24th Mechanized Brigade named after King Danylo — ‘Hero’s Cross.’
He was a brave warrior, commander, reliable friend, and loving son. His heart always beat for his loved ones and for Ukraine. “We bow our heads in gratitude before our Hero. Mykhailo, you will forever remain alive in our hearts.”
